The Dell Laptop That Was Injured During An 8hr. Sleepover

by James Valle

Do you use a laptop or netbook? If you do, we do not recommend using a laptop or netbook on your bed or sofa because they can overheat due to poor circulation, but most importantly you might accidentally sleep on it like what happened to this notebook.

This Dell Latitude D630 laptop suffered an 8 hour ordeal of getting rolled over several times which finally ended by falling off the bed and landing on a hard wood floor. Which in return, cracked the screen and left side of the LCD bezel. The right hinge, one key, and also the right side of the power button hinge cover all broke. We were able to safe this notebook and it is now back into service, working 100%.

Xi3 5 Series Modular Computer Review

by James Valle

This 5 Series is a unique cube-like computer with a classic motherboard that has been divided into three interconnecting boards, the CPU board and two I/O boards.

The model of this 5 Series is the X5A-5342US00, running Windows 7 and it is powered by an AMD Ahtlon Dual-core 64-bit 3400e processor. It comes with a 64GB Solid State Drive and 2GB of DDR2 RAM.

Features.
 Useful life of 6 – 10 years
 Low energy use (20 Watts)
 Significant TCO (total cost of ownership) savings vs. standard PCs
 Easily upgradeable & modifiable
 Very small footprint
 Boots Windows 7 in under 25 seconds
 Runs x86-based Operating Systems and Software

In the package, it contains the computer, power adapter with cord, start-up guide and the limited warranty booklet.

The modular computer has a nice brushed aluminum housing with vented chromed sides. On the front you have the Xi3 logo, nothing on the other two sides and on the backside is the I/O panel.

Starting on the top left and going down, you have the Ethernet port, Sound in Sound out and the Mic inputs. To the right of the Ethernet port, you have two video connectors, the Display Port and the Dual Link DVI+VGA connectors which both support dual displays. Here you have the power adapter port and the power button. Below that, you have 6 USB 2.0 ports, one is dedicated for the keyboard and two eSata ports.

The things we liked about this computer are:
– The AMD Athlon processor
– Solid state drive
– Supports dual displays
– Upgradable and modifiable
– Supports multiple operating systems like Linux

There were very few things we didn’t like about the Xi3. We didn’t like that the maximum amount of RAM you can have is 2GB and we weren’t too fond of the price which was about $600.

This would be a great computer for the industrial control market, medical industry, computer labs, retail service kiosk, or even at home as a basic computer or multimedia computer.

Samsung Series 7 Gamer Laptop Review

by Mark Valle

The Samsung Series 7 Gamer is an ultimate gaming laptop designed to offer the hardcore gamer a customized, versatile and powerful gaming machine.

The model of this gaming laptop is NP700G7C-S01US and it is powered by a third generation Intel® Core™ i7-3610QM Processor running at 2.3Ghz that can be turbo boosted up to 3.3Ghz in gaming mode. It comes with two 750GB hard drives totaling 1.5TB with 8GB of ExpressCache. It comes with 16GB of DDR3 RAM which is the maximum allowed in this laptop. Viewing content is displayed on an amazing full HD 1920×1080 SuperBright Plus display with a brightness of 400nit, powered by an NVIDIA® GeForce® GTX 675M with 2GB of graphical memory. Sound is powered by Dolby Home Theater v4 surround sound speakers. It comes with a 101 backlit keyboard with u shaped keys. 2.0 megapixel web cam. On the right side you it has a Blu-Ray/Super Multi Dual Layer DVD drive and two USB 2.0 ports. On the left side it has the Kensington Lock Slot, the power port, the LAN port, VGA port, HDMI port, two USB 3.0 ports, the 7 in 1 multi card slot, mic in jack and the headphone out jack.
For connectivity you have a 802.11 a/b/g/n and the RJ45 Gigabit Ethernet. It also comes with Bluetooth version 4.0.

The laptop has a professional brushed black metal look. It has light enhancements when laptop is turned on at the touchpad, keyboard and the top control panel. On the top control panel, you have controls for the volume, mute, wi-fi, the backlit keyboard and the power. Here on the right side is the 4 mode dial switch which gives you different power plans. The first is the Eco mode which gives you the maximum battery life. The second is the library mode where mutes the speakers, brightens the display and the fans are turned off. The third is the balance mode which is the every day mode. All components are balanced to give you great everyday laptop experience. And the last is the gaming mode which turbo charges the CPU and the graphics card for optimization for the latest games.

On the back, you have two vents which blow out the hot air by two huge fans. Watching blu-ray movies on the Full HD SuperBright Plus display is very amazing with every detail you will notice. The sound from the 2 way Dolby Home Theater v4 surround sound system is loud, clear with no distortion and it is also customizable. Even though there is a sub-woofer built-in, the low end frequency is lacking.

While gaming, the battery is not sufficient for extreme games, you will notice a drop in frame rate. It is recommended to keep the ac adapter plugged in.

This is a great gaming laptop/desktop replacement. Not a laptop to carry around since it weights close to 9lbs. For a gaming laptop with all the great features, it is price at $1900.00 which is good deal.

Logitech K400 Wireless Touch Keyboard Review

by James Valle

We have seen a lot of wireless keyboard and mouse combos like Adesso, IBM and many others. We were really impressed with the Logitech K400 wireless touch keyboard because it is lightweight, compact and performs well.

The K400 wireless touch keyboard comes with a USB unifying receiver, USB extender, comes with two AA batteries and the getting started instructions. The K400 wireless touch keyboard is a lot smaller than an average sized laptop keyboard which has a built-in touchpad with left and right click buttons. Also has another left click button at the top left corner of the keyboard, media hot keys, and an on/off switch to conserve the batteries.

These are the things we liked about the keyboard:
– Lightweight
– Compact
– Easy to store, space-saving
– Compatible with Windows, Linux and Mac with some limitations
– Touchpad included, no need for a seperate mouse
– Extra left click button
– Plug and play
– Tiny USB unifying receiver can connect up to six compatible unifying wireless devices
– Low-profile keys
– Media hot keys
– Batteries included
– On/off switch
– 2 year warranty
– Up to 12 month battery life depending on usage
– Wireless range up to 33 feat
– Good price of $34.99 from Newegg.com

The things we disliked about the keyboard:
– No low battery indicator
– Flimsy and fragile
– No Apple Mac drivers
– No 3 or 4 finger swipe commands for Mac computers
– Keyboard size smaller than an average laptop keyboard.

Over all, it’s a great keyboard to own especially if your using it for entertainment purposes.

Raspberry Pi Overview and Raspbian Installation

by James Valle

The Raspberry Pi is a credit card sized single-board computer developed in the UK by the Raspberry Pi Foundation with the intention of stimulating the teaching of basic computer science in schools.

The Raspberry PI has a Broadcom BCM2835 system on a chip which includes a 700MHz processor, videocore IV GPU, and 256MB of RAM. The Raspberry Pi does not include a built-in hard disk, but uses an SD card for booting and long term storage. You can also install a hard disk via USB. There are two Raspberry Pi versions available, the Model A which is priced at $25.00 and Model B priced at $35.00. Model A comes with one USB 2.0 port and no ethernet port. Model B comes with two USB 2.0 ports, a 10/100 ethernet (RJ45) port, a HDMI port, a 3.5mm audio jack output and a composite RCA output.

To power the Raspberry Pi, you will need a micro USB cable and a minimum 700mA – 1200mA, 3.5w, 5v USB AC adapter. The Motorola USB phone chargers are the best ones to use because most have a rating of 700mA – 1500mA. If you are running resource intensive applications or plugged in peripherals that draw more current, make sure the mA rating is enough to support it.

Today, we will be installing Raspbian, which is the newest version of Debian, optimized for the Raspberry Pi. Applications run faster on Raspbian than other distribution of Linux ported to the Raspberry Pi. You can download Raspbian from the Raspbian’s website.

Before proceeding, you will need a USB keyboard/mouse combo, SDHC/micro SDHC memory card with a minimum of 4GB to install Raspbian. A monitor that supports either HDMI or composite RCA video cable is needed.

Samsung Galaxy Nexus Event in Baltimore, Maryland

by James Valle

We had the honor to be invited to the Samsung Galaxy Nexus Event on May 8th, 2012 at the Power Plant Live in Baltimore, MD. The event was to launch and introduce the Galaxy Nexus smartphone for Sprint’s 4G LTE network.

The Galaxy Nexus is an amazing phone with many cool features like face unlock, type with your voice, android beam, zero shutter lag, single-motion panoramic mode, 1080 HD video, snap still shots while recording video, google wallet and many more features.
